This Cozy Newer Construction Lives Large On Llano

Let’s head down to Lower Greenville to check out this little stunner on Llano Avenue. Llano? LLANO. Killer location. Walking distance to Terelli’s, and Tietze Park and Pool just a few steps in the other direction. It’s tucked away yet close to it all and there’s a lot to love about this one.

It was built in 2015 and it’s a pier and beam!! Now there’s a great debate on foundations, but if you’re Team Pier & Beam, you totally get it. The way cool thing about 5723 Llano Avenue is even though it’s newer construction, it fits the feel of the neighborhood. Expansive porch out front, big backyard with a putting green, and a gate that runs along the alley for extra space and privacy.

That means it’s a rear garage, too, which is ANOTHER debate, but I’m all in on alleys. Inside, you have all the wonderful, wonderful custom details you find in newer construction. Nice big rooms, a LARGE kitchen, closets, and that nice general newness. Hardwoods throughout the house, modern paint colors, lots of lovely neutrals, big ol’ bathrooms, and our beloved double sink vanities.

Upstairs you’ll find the primary bedroom with a loft right outside that you can turn into an exercise room, an office, a nursery, a study, a playroom, or a place to keep your essential oils. Whatever you want. It’s yours. It also creates a nice separation if you want to keep kids or company downstairs.

There are also two living areas and currently one bedroom is being used as a third living area. Want to turn it back into a bedroom? It’s easy. Just pop those doors back on and you’re good to go.

This home has been exceptionally well maintained and it was great to begin with, but the current owners made it even better. They added a new roof and gutters in 2020, a sump pump, and added some energy efficient updates. I’m sure this one will go quickly so if you’re interested, snag it.

Dave Perry-Miller’s Michelle Foreman has listed 5723 Llano Ave. at $799,000.
